SHCA's Judges' Mentor Program
In response to AKC's request to provide them with a list of Parent Club-approved mentors for aspiring Siberian Husky judges, the Judges' Education Committee polled twelve breeder-judges for suggested mentor requirements. Following is a list compiled from the suggestions submitted, and agreed upon by the group.

Please note that these requirements are more stringent than those proposed by AKC. As the mentors are SHCA-approved, it was felt that mentors should be SHCA members. The mentor workshop will include such topics and miscellaneous requirements such as an individual may not mentor a class in which he or she has a Siberian in competition; how to stimulate and answer all questions by adhereing to the Standard for Siberian Huskies; never offering a coment contrary to what appears in the Standard; not offering opinions about people, specific dogs, and kennels; how to answer questions; things to consider and discuss; etc.
RINGSIDE OBSERVATION MENTORING UPDATE
Approved Siberian Husky mentors will want to be aware of the recent revision to the Ringside Observation parameters established by the American Kennel Club. To quote the notice as published in the Judges' Newsletter:
"Effective immediately, qualified mentors will be allowed to participate in Ringside Observation on days they have entries in the breed they are teaching until the class at which they have an entry assembles. From that time on they are to refrain from further interaction."
This, of course, allows approved mentors to be more easily available since many mentors are also Siberian Husky exhibitors. But, exhibitors as mentors must clearly understand that as their class assembles, they MUST remove themselves from any area of mentoring. As a requirement set forth by AKC, it automatically becomes a requirement of the Siberian Husky Club of America, Inc.
